Brompton Bicycle in Greenford is seeking a Production Quality Technician to join the Plant Quality team. You will inspect bicycles, assemblies and processes, contributing to containment, validation and continuous improvement across manufacturing operations.
You'll work closely with Production, Engineering and Quality to identify quality concerns, perform audits and drive Right First Time, while maintaining safe, accurate records and a strong quality mindset.
Job title: Production Quality Technician
Location, Hours: Greenford, 40 hours per week
Reporting to: Quality Engineer
For 50 years Brompton has existed to ‘create urban freedom for happier lives. By providing the means to travel and explore with a bike you can take anywhere and store anywhere we make cities better places to live. Our high-quality products and market leading brand combined with a global need for smarter urban transport means we are enjoying strong, sustained growth. To continue to thrive we need great people who can innovate and deliver. Brompton is a truly global company exporting 80% of our production to 45 countries around the world. In 2024 Brompton celebrated making our millionth bike. The majority of these are in regular use around the world. This is an exciting opportunity to join Brompton's Plant Quality team and play a hands-on role in ensuring that our bicycles consistently meet the required quality and safety standards and deliver an excellent customer experience.
As a Production Quality Technician, you will work closely with Production, Manufacturing Engineering, Quality, Design and other supporting functions to identify concerns, contribute to effective problem solving and help drive continuous improvement across our manufacturing operations.
The role combines practical inspection with structured problem solving and day-to-day production support. You will inspect bicycles, assemblies and manufacturing processes, participate in containment and validation activities, and help ensure that quality concerns are identified, understood and addressed through the appropriate processes.
We are looking for someone who is hands-on, curious and collaborative - someone who asks why, thinks critically and looks beyond simply identifying defects. Strong attention to detail and the confidence to communicate quality concerns clearly and constructively are essential. You do not need to know everything on day one; what matters most is a strong quality mindset, a willingness to learn and a genuine interest in manufacturing and continuous improvement.
